Prepare patient charts prior to medical and behavioral encounters (upload orders, referrals, imaging, etc.)
Collect and document vital signs, urine drug screen, and initial patient screening information (Temperature, COVID forms, etc.)
Document medical and behavioral encounters in health record management systems (prep, complete patient record with Dx,Hx, care plan, CC/HPI, billing info, etc.)
Administer and process consent forms and other patient questionnaires as needed
Document injection consents, prep and assist with injections
Provide patient support in the clinic including schedule appointments, enter authorization dates, appointment confirmation calls, medical records requests and follow up on appeals and/or denials
Assist medical and behavioral provider in writing and transferring orders
Process imaging orders as per provider request (complete forms, send tasks & document), transfer imaging from partner portals into health record management systems
Administer urine drug screen and record results. Assist medical provider with UDS interpretation and process UDS confirmation as necessary
Obtain and assist medical provider in reviewing the Controlled Substance Utilization Review and Evaluation System (CURES) report
